Richland restaurant known for its fish dishes has closed

A Richland restaurant known for its Bang Bang Shrimp dish has closed.

Bonefish Grill – located in a strip mall at 133 W. Gage Blvd. – permanently closed Dec. 17 and is no longer listed on Bonefish’s website.

The Richland restaurant first opened in January 2006, according to state Department of Revenue records.

The Bonefish Grill restaurant chain is part of Bloomin’ Brands Inc., a Tampa, Florida-based company which also operates Outback Steakhouse, Carrabba’s Italian Grill and Fleming’s Prime Steakhouse & Wine Bar.

Bloomin’ Brands announced in November that it had closed 21 restaurants in its portfolio as part of a turnaround strategy. The company also said it decided to not renew the leases at 22 others, the majority of which expire over the next four years. It didn’t list the affected restaurants.

A request for comment from Bloomin’ Brands was not returned.

A Richland employee said that those with Bonefish gift cards could use them at Outback Steakhouse, 6819 W. Canal Drive, Kennewick, including for online or to-go orders.

The only other Bonefish restaurant in the state is in Marysville.
